About the Studio
We are representing an award-winning interior design practice specialising in immersive, high-quality spaces across the hotel, hospitality and commercial sectors. The studio takes a holistic approach to design, creating sensory-rich environments that enhance how people experience and interact with a space.
Role Overview
We are seeking a talented and experienced Part 3 Architect to join the studio and contribute to the delivery of ambitious, design-led projects from concept through to completion. This is a full-time, hybrid role based in London, with flexibility to work from home two days per week.
Key Responsibilities
- Develop design proposals and translate creative concepts into well-resolved, technically robust and buildable solutions.
- Work closely with interior designers, architects, consultants, contractors and clients.
- Coordinate architectural information across all project stages.
- Produce and review technical and construction drawings.
- Coordinate consultant information.
- Support the delivery of projects on site.
- Take ownership of architectural packages.
- Contribute to design development and technical reviews.
- Identify and resolve design and construction issues.
- Maintain a high level of quality throughout the project lifecycle.

Key Requirements
- Fully qualified Part 3 Architect with strong post-qualification experience.
- Strong understanding of architectural design, construction, detailing and project delivery.
- Excellent knowledge of UK Building Regulations, planning, construction methods, materials and architectural detailing.
- Strong proficiency in Revit, with experience working within BIM environments.
- Experience coordinating multidisciplinary teams and consultant information.
- Experience working with contractors and interpreting information on site.
- Confident communicator with excellent organisational and problem-solving skills.
- Comfortable taking responsibility for your work while collaborating effectively within a creative and multidisciplinary team.
- Keen eye for detail, strong design sensibility and the ability to balance design ambition with technical and commercial considerations.
